Judge: Parents can’t see ’93 evidence

WEST MEMPHIS - A circuit judge has ruled against allowing the parents of two West Memphis 8-year-olds killed in 1993 to look at evidence in the case. Crittenden County Circuit Judge Victor Hill dismissed a Freedom of Information Act lawsuit Tuesday filed by Pam Hicks and joined by John Mark Byers...
